If you ’ve ever wonder why you ca n’t seem to get enough of these frustrating games , scientists have an answer . As computer scientist Paul SchratertoldScientific American , it ’s all about the challenge . allot to Schrater , humans are inherently goal - seeking . The operation of process toward a goal may be unenjoyable or even downright irritating , but the satisfaction of reach a goal — and later on being able to release it — more than makes up for the frustration .

But if you desire to get even faster at find hidden objects in mental image , there are some strategies you’re able to use . Family Games Guiderecommendsthat you play along your first instincts when searching for out - of - post oddities . Some researchers have even go so far as to create algorithms that map out out the best searching strategies . Where ’s Waldo , one of the most far-famed secret objective search games , has been the subject ofseveralof these experiment . grant to oneexperiment , you should check first in the bottom left part of the effigy and then move to the bottom justly if you have n’t found Waldo by then .
